Since the 16th century, taxidermy has merged scientific curiosity with artistic imitation of character

This method enabled the museum to develop an enormous assortment of taxidermy birds.[10] While in the nineteenth century, some hunters took their trophies to upholstery retailers, the place the upholsterers would sew up the animal skins and things them with rags and cotton. The expression "stuffing" or a "stuffed animal" evolved from this crude method of taxidermy. Expert taxidermists favor the time period "mounting" to "stuffing". Far more refined cotton-wrapped wire bodies supporting sewn-on cured skins quickly followed.

It's then both mounted on a mannequin produced from Wooden wool and wire, or simply a polyurethane kind. Clay is employed to put in glass eyes and will also be employed for facial capabilities like cheekbones in addition to a prominent brow bone. Modeling clay can be utilized to reform features likewise; if the appendage was torn or broken, clay can keep it jointly and add muscle detail. Forms and eyes are commercially offered from many suppliers. Otherwise, taxidermists carve or Solid their own personal types.[37]
